英文摘要A method for starting a trusted embedded platform based on TPM industrial control includes taking a Core Root of Trust Measurement (CRTM) as a source of a trust chain and executing CRTM after electrifying an embedded platform; conducting trust measurement of BIOS and starting BIOS after passing measurement; BIOS measuring Bootloader and extending a measured value into PCR corresponding to TPM; after passing the measurement, transferring a control execution right to Bootloader; and Bootloader measuring OS kernel start process, recording a measured value into PCR of TPM, and executing a start flow of OS after passing the measurement. The method performs measurement before start of each part of a start process, and measured values are also stored in the PCR corresponding to TPM. When the start process is tampered by an attacker, an integrity measurement mechanism terminates the execution of a program, thereby ensuring the security of the embedded platform.
